YES! Afghanistan comes from behind to defeat Canada!

Afghans celebrate win

After a tough four days of competition against the Canadian cricket team, the Afghan team pulled it together in the end, and handed the Canadians a loud defeat.В  Afghanistan 264 and 494 for 4 (Shahzad 215, Nabi 80, Mangal 70) beat Canada 566 and 191 for 4 dec by six wickets at the Intercontinental Cup at Sharjah, United Arab Emirates.В  Afghanistan is now on top the Intercontinental Cup table and is considered by many as one of the strongest associate nations.В  Many cricket fans, worldwide, agree that the Afghan cricket team’s story of how they rose amongst the ranks is one of the most inspirational stories in cricket history.

Scoreboard: Canada (1st innings): 566. Afghanistan (1st innings): 264. Canada (2nd innings): 191. Afghanistan (2nd innings / overnight 40 for no loss): Karim Sadiq c Hansra b Rizwan Cheema 42, Noor Ali c Bastiampillai b Dhaniram 52, Mohammad Shahzad (not out) 215, Nowroz Mangal c & b David 70, Mohammad Nabi c sub (HS Baidwan) b Patel 80, Asghar Stanikzai (not out) 22. Extras: (b-5, lb-3, w-4, nb-1) 13. Total: (for 4 wickets; 106.4 overs) 494. Fall of Wickets: 1-70, 2-119, 3-282, 4-460. Bowling: Rizwan Cheema 22-0-119-1 (1w), Khurram Chohan 17-1-72-0, NR Kumar 8.4-1-43-0, S Jyoti 24-0-105-0, H Patel 8-1-47-1 (2w), S Dhaniram 11-2-30-1, R David 16-0-70-1 (1nb).
